Corporate Governance and Shareholder Activism in India: A Contemporary Analysis

 This research paper provides an in-depth examination of corporate governance standards and shareholder activism in India’s dynamic and growing corporate landscape. The study’s goal is to shed light on the current situation of corporate governance in India, as well as its interaction with the growing phenomena of shareholder activism. In recent years, India has seen a substantial shift in corporate governance norms, owing to regulatory reforms and a greater emphasis on openness, accountability, and ethical business practices. The regulatory framework controlling corporate governance in India is examined in this article, including the role of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) and the Companies Act, 2013, in developing corporate governance principles. The article digs into the changing dynamics of corporate governance procedures, as well as the growing impact of shareholder activism on altering company behavior. This magazine strives to emphasize the problems and opportunities offered by shareholder activism in India through an examination of key legislative frameworks, case studies, and international comparisons, ultimately contributing to a more nuanced understanding of its impact on corporate governance.
